π Why Choose a Mazda3 with Manual Transmission?
Letβs face itβmanual cars are becoming dinosaurs in the automotive world π¦, but the Mazda3 Angular sticks to its roots by offering an engaging six-speed stick shift. For those who crave control over their ride, this is more than just a car; itβs a connection between driver and machine.
But what makes it so special? The Mazda3 isnβt just about horsepowerβitβs all about how it feels behind the wheel. With sporty handling, precise gear changes, and a peppy engine, every drive becomes an adventure. Plus, the interior design screams "premium" without breaking the bank πΈ. Who needs luxury brands when you can have this level of refinement?
π― What Makes the Driving Experience So Unique?
Imagine yourself cruising down your favorite backroad on a sunny day βοΈ. You press the clutch pedal, shift smoothly through gears, and hear the symphony of the engine roaring as you accelerate. Thatβs exactly what owning a Mazda3 Angular manual feels like.
Hereβs why drivers rave about it: β
Skyactiv technology ensures efficiency while delivering spirited performance π;
β
G-Vectoring Control Plus keeps things balanced during turns (you wonβt feel like spinning out at high speeds);
β
A low center of gravity gives the car go-kart-like agilityβperfect for twisty roads or city streets alike ποΈ;
And letβs not forget the soulful exhaust note that makes even short trips exciting π.
π‘ Is It Worth Buying in 2024?
While automatic transmissions dominate the market, choosing a manual version means opting for something unique. However, there are trade-offs to consider:
π Pros: Better fuel economy compared to many rivals, unmatched fun factor, and fewer distractions from modern tech bells-and-whistles.
π Cons: Limited availability in some regions, slightly higher maintenance costs due to wear on clutches, and maybe less practical for daily commutes stuck in traffic π¦..
Ultimately, if you prioritize driving enjoyment over convenience, the Mazda3 Angular manual could be your dream car. Just donβt forget to practice hill startsβyouβll need them! π
